Kem might be right to worry about hurting himself as a number of contestants have been injured on the show.
WENN
In 2007, TV presenter Andi Peters broke his ankle and journalist Kay Burley suffered a head injury in training.
In 2012, actress Jennifer Ellison cut her head open with the blade of her skate.
